Chichester Roman Week
Back to Top of ListFor a truly unique family friendly thing to do in Chichester this May Half Term, Chichester Roman Week is an absolute must.
Running from Tuesday 26 to Saturday 30 May 2026 and now in its tenth year, this brilliant annual programme of events takes a closer look at the fascinating Roman history of Chichester District, when the city was known as Noviomagus Reginorum.
Across five days, families, adults and anyone curious about life in Roman Chichester can enjoy talks from archaeologists and historians, guided tours of Roman and archaeological collections, family friendly storytelling and craft sessions, and partner events at venues across the district.
One of the real highlights is the Roman re-enactment day in Priory Park with Legio Secunda Augusta, bringing history to life in the most spectacular way.
You can still spot the very traces of Roman Chichester today, from the ancient city walls to the Roman bathhouse beneath The Novium Museum itself, making this a wonderfully immersive May Half Term experience.

Fontwell Park Family Festival Raceday
Back to Top of ListFollowing its hugely popular debut last year, the Fontwell Park Family Festival Raceday 2026 is back for the May Bank Holiday weekend and is one of the most exciting family friendly things to do near Chichester this May Half Term.
Taking place on Sunday 24 May 2026, this fun-filled day combines the thrill of live jump racing with a vibrant festival atmosphere, including traditional fun fair rides, face painting, a live entertainment stage and energetic children's fitness classes.
Racegoers of all ages can cheer on the runners, soak up the lively atmosphere and enjoy a full afternoon of action-packed racing, all included in the ticket price.
With kids aged 17 and under going free with a paying adult and a family ticket available for just £25 for two adults and up to six children, it's fantastic value for a brilliant Bank Holiday day out.

Shoreline and Seaside Fun at the children's Marine Ecology Club
Back to Top of ListThis May half term, Mulberry Marine Experiences in West Sussex offers hands-on, family friendly Children's Marine Ecology Club for children aged 6-12. Led by SSI Marine Ecology Instructor Anya, with over 20 years of UK experience, the Club introduces young ocean lovers to coastal ecosystems, shoreline inhabitants, and key marine concepts through games, activities and exploration. Each two-hour session is beach-based, dry, and designed for all abilities, with adults free to accompany their children. Sessions run in small groups during school holidays, with indoor alternatives if the weather isn’t suitable.
The Village Fete and Dog Show at Bignor Park
Back to Top of ListIf you are looking for a classic, quintessentially British family friendly thing to do near Chichester this May Bank Holiday, look no further than the Village Fete and Dog Show at beautiful Bignor Park on Sunday 24 May 2026.
This fun-filled day out has something for children, adults and dogs alike, with a fantastic Dog Show, a Dog Agility Demonstration by Billingshurst Dog Training Club, live music from the Petworth Town Band and a wonderful performance from the Fishbourne Mill Morris Dancers.
Little ones can enjoy Punch and Judy, a coconut shy, welly wanging, golf putting, splat the rat and egg throwing, while grown-ups can browse an excellent selection of stalls including plant sales, vintage clothes, second hand books, gifts and interiors, and the ever popular Aladdin's Cave Antiques in the Stable Yard.
When it comes to food and drink, you are spoilt for choice, with hog roast baps, hot dogs and burgers from Sophie's Kitchen, homemade cakes in the Stable House Cafe, ice cream from De Luca's and a bar serving Pimms, local beers, wine and soft drinks. Even better, all proceeds go towards the repair and upkeep of five beautiful Norman and Saxon churches in the local area.

Elmer and Friends | The Novium Museum
Back to Top of ListThe wonderful Elmer and Friends: The Colourful World of David McKee exhibition is a brilliant family friendly thing to do in Chichester this May Half Term, especially on a rainy day or if you simply want to do something inside.
Running from Saturday 18 April right through to Sunday 13 September 2026 at the Novium Museum, Chichester, West Sussex.
Created by Seven Stories, the National Centre for Children's Books, this gorgeous multi-sensory, interactive exhibition celebrates and explores the iconic stories of David McKee through original artworks, making it a perfect choice for younger children and fans of the much-loved patchwork elephant.
With plenty to see, touch and explore, it is also a fantastic option for things to do when it is raining near Chichester this May Half Term and May Bank Holiday.
